Researchers Develop Nano-structures That Enable Ultrafast Changes In Light Polarisation

Researchers at King’s College London have developed a series of nano-structured materials that rapidly change the polarisation of light faster than electronic methods currently allow. The materials, described in today’s Nature Photonics, could lead to faster data transfer rates, better quantum computer construction and advanced research into new materials.
